This sake displays the peak abilities of the brewery, and is made in very small batches. The reason is due to handling highly polished rice, and using a natural drip pressing method. The labor spent is worth it. This sake graces you with a light aroma of fruit candy, which prepares you for the sweet, silky smooth texture that hints of cotton candy. Definitely a treat.

Brand | Kaika |
Brewery | Daiichi Brewing Company |
Category | Daiginjo |
Subcategory | Genshu |
Taste Profile | Light & Sweet |
Rice variety | Yamadanishiki |
Yeast variety | Tochigi Yeast |
Alcohol | 17.00% |
RPR | 38% |
SMV | 2 |
Acidity | 1.1 |
Founded in 1673, Daiichi Brewing Company is the oldest brewery in Tochigi Prefecture which has endured many challenges over time.
